I'm posting what I've found to either hope someone else has found other
pieces or if this may help someone else:

I believe this power on problem is a WM2003 or .NET issue. If I have
CeRunAppAtTIme run a non-.NET application (such as a basic form, or any
other basic app, it runs fine, turns on the screen, etc. However, as soon
as I have this command execute a .NET exe, the screen will never turn on.

Ideas?
